What is the Highwall Auger Mining Calculator?

This calculator helps you determine the optimal parameters for highwall auger mining operations, including pillar dimensions, web spacing, and extraction ratios to ensure both safety and production efficiency.

Applications

Highwall auger mining is particularly valuable in scenarios where:

Resource Recovery

  • Recovery of coal from abandoned highwalls
  • Extraction from otherwise uneconomic reserves
  • Accessing coal seams without full-scale mining

Planning & Safety

  • Optimizing extraction ratios
  • Ensuring highwall stability
  • Planning web and barrier pillar dimensions
